Caffetteria Chiostro del Bramante

Vicolo della Pace, 5, 00186 Roma RM, Italy

A hidden café inside the 15th-century Renaissance cloister of Bramante — one of the most unique coffee experiences in Rome, tucked in a warren of lanes off Piazza Navona. The café occupies the upper loggia overlooking the square inner courtyard: no ticket to the art museum is needed to access it. Order the signature macchiatone (a long coffee in a cappuccino cup topped with frothed milk) or their Bramante Coffee (coffee, chocolate cream, frothed milk, in a wine glass). Light bites, pastries, and cocktails also available.
